Course details
Robotics Fundamentals: This unit covers the basics of robotics, including mechanical, electrical, and software components, as well as control systems and sensors. •
Artificial Intelligence for Healthcare: This unit delves into the application of AI in healthcare, including machine learning, natural language processing, and computer vision, with a focus on autonomous healthcare robotics implementation. •
Computer Vision for Robotics: This unit explores the use of computer vision in robotics, including image processing, object recognition, and tracking, essential for autonomous healthcare robots to navigate and interact with patients. •
Machine Learning for Robotics: This unit covers the application of machine learning algorithms in robotics, including supervised and unsupervised learning, regression, and classification, to enable autonomous decision-making in healthcare settings. •
Human-Robot Interaction: This unit focuses on the design and development of human-robot interfaces, including natural language processing, gesture recognition, and haptic feedback, to ensure safe and effective interaction between humans and autonomous healthcare robots. •
Robotics and Healthcare Law: This unit examines the legal frameworks governing the development and deployment of autonomous healthcare robots, including regulatory compliance, liability, and ethics. •
Robotics and Healthcare Ethics: This unit explores the ethical considerations surrounding the development and use of autonomous healthcare robots, including patient autonomy, informed consent, and data privacy. •
Robotics and Healthcare Infrastructure: This unit discusses the design and development of healthcare infrastructure to support the integration of autonomous healthcare robots, including hospital layouts, workflow optimization, and staff training. •
Robotics and Healthcare Cybersecurity: This unit focuses on the cybersecurity risks associated with autonomous healthcare robots, including data breaches, hacking, and malware, and provides strategies for mitigating these risks. •
Robotics and Healthcare Economic Evaluation: This unit evaluates the economic feasibility of autonomous healthcare robots, including cost-benefit analysis, return on investment, and payback period, to inform decision-making in healthcare organizations.

**Career Roles and Statistics**
| **Role** | Description |
|---|---|
| **Healthcare Robotics Engineer** | Designs and develops autonomous healthcare robots for medical procedures, patient care, and research. Ensures robots are safe, efficient, and effective. |
| **Robotics Research Scientist** | Conducts research on autonomous healthcare robotics, including sensor development, machine learning algorithms, and human-robot interaction. |
| **Clinical Robotics Specialist** | Works with healthcare professionals to integrate autonomous robots into clinical settings, ensuring seamless patient care and data analysis. |
| **Artificial Intelligence/Machine Learning Engineer** | Develops AI/ML algorithms for autonomous healthcare robots, enabling them to learn from data and make informed decisions. |
